Shot during a short hike along the Seven Lakes path in Vermuntila, Rauma, Finland.
This picture is part of a series of forest and hiking themed pictures I've been capturing during the COVID-19 pandemic. In Finland restrictions on moving outdoors have been relatively minor and people have started to explore various hiking paths and nature reservations instead of going to the city.

Het Amerongse Bos is één van de oudste bossen op de Utrechtse Heuvelrug. Dat is op zichzelf niet zo bijzonder omdat de meeste bossen op de Heuvelrug pas ongeveer honderd jaar oud zijn. Het Amerongse Bos steekt hier echter met kop en schouders bovenuit: sommige grove dennen dateren uit 1770. Het bos dankt zijn leeftijd aan de kasteelheren van het in de Amerongse Bovenpolder gelegen kasteel Amerongen. Zij lieten het bos aanleggen om er te kunnen jagen. Naast zijn ouderdom heeft het Amerongse Bos nóg een bijzonderheid. Het bos ligt namelijk op de 69 meter hoge Amerongse Berg, het hoogste punt van de Utrechtse Heuvelrug.
